Course Content

• Introduction to Cellular Respiration and its Importance
• Mitochondrial Biology and Dysfunction in Developmental Disorders
• Genetic Basis of Mitochondrial Diseases & Cellular Respiration Defects
• Metabolic Pathways and their Interplay in Cellular Respiration
• Cellular Respiration & Oxidative Stress in Neurodevelopmental Disorders
• Assessment and Diagnosis of Cellular Respiration Disorders
• Therapeutic Strategies for Cellular Respiration Developmental Disorders
• Case Studies: Exploring Diverse Manifestations of Mitochondrial Diseases
• Research Methods in Cellular Respiration and Developmental Disorders
• Ethical Considerations in Genetic Testing and Treatment

Career path

Career Role (Cellular Respiration & Developmental Disorders) Description
Research Scientist (Mitochondrial Disorders) Investigating genetic and metabolic pathways in mitochondrial diseases; crucial for developing novel therapies. High demand for expertise in cellular respiration.
Genetic Counselor (Developmental Disorders) Providing genetic counseling to families affected by developmental disorders with cellular respiration links; interpreting complex genetic data. Strong understanding of cellular respiration pathways required.
Bioinformatician (Metabolic Pathway Analysis) Analyzing large datasets of genomic and metabolic data to identify disease biomarkers and therapeutic targets related to cellular respiration. Essential skills in bioinformatics and cellular biology are necessary.
Clinical Research Associate (Developmental Biology) Managing clinical trials for novel therapies targeting developmental disorders with underlying cellular respiration defects. Requires strong understanding of clinical trial protocols and cellular respiration.
